Phoenix Studio (also called Phoenix Interactive) was a France video game developer based in Lyon, producer of the cancelled Rayman 4. The company was cooperating with Ubisoft. The studio was closed in November 2009 due to financial problems.[1]

C.E.O of the studio was Pierre Arnaud Mousson, studio director was Pascall Stradella.

Games developed and co-developed by Phoenix

  • Winnie the Pooh's Rumbly Tumbly Adventure
  • Movie Studios Party
  • Petz Rescue Endangered Paradise
  • Petz: Horse Club / Imagine: Champion Rider
  • Petz: Horsez 2 / Pippa Funnell: Ranch Rescue
  • Arthur and the Revenge of Maltazard (game)
  • Rayman 4 (cancelled)

Issues with the company name

Numerous sources link Phoenix Studio to another company called Phoenix Interactive Entertainment. The second team was a British video games developer that produced two titles between 1995 and 1997. In addition, LinkedIn falsely connects some former employees of the French studio to Phoenix Interactive Design, a Canadian ATM software company.
